Selective Fischer–Tropsch synthesis for jet fuel production over Y<sup>3+</sup> modified Co/H-β catalysts

Abstract

Y<sup>3+</sup>, exchanged with the H protons in zeolites, decreased the acid strength of Co/Y-β-<italic>x</italic> (<italic>x</italic> = 1, 2, 3, 4) catalysts, which reduced the selectivity of gaseous hydrocarbons (C<sub>1</sub>–C<sub>4</sub>) and promoted the generation of JFRHs.
